As the only clean, low-carbon, safe and efficient basic load energy, nuclear energy has been increasingly developed in major nuclear power nations around world. At the same time, nuclear energy also plays a positive role in responding to global climate change. After the Fukushima nuclear accident, the international community has put forward new and higher requirements for the safety of nuclear energy. The world?s nuclear energy community is exploring and developing advanced nuclear energy technology with a view to solving the economic, safety and environmental issues in the development of nuclear energy. This article summarizes the development trends of advanced nuclear energy technology in international organizations and major nuclear power countries, it introduces the development of advanced nuclear energy technology in China, and it also analyzes the future development trend, the crucial development directions and common technologies of advanced nuclear energy.
